我是Babel的新手,正尝试通过标头“ Content-Type”作为“ application / json”发出POST请求。 是否有用于更改Request标头的文档?

  import Request from 'request-promise-native'
  const result = await Request
      .post(`some url`)
      .auth(authId, secretToken,false)
      .form({
        text: "hello"
      })
  console.log(result);
  return JSON.parse(result)

#1楼 票数:0

只需添加标头对象,如下所示:

.headers({
    'Content-Type': 'application/json'
})

  ask by Abhishek Anand translate from so

未解决问题?本站智能推荐:

1回复

如何从Node.js中的请求标头中删除单引号

基本上,我有一个简单的标头对象。 当我使用节点js上的带有request-promise的标头对象发送请求时,它超时到Web URL。 当我发送原始标头时,没有其他邮递员类型的客户端中包含引号, 该请求丢失并继续,没有理由。 这可能真是愚蠢,但我无法弄清楚这里发生了什么。
1回复

如何在请求承诺对象中调用异步函数?

我有一个功能如下: 但我收到这个错误 T 认为这是因为我在请求中调用了一个异步函数。 如何在请求中调用异步函数? 提前致谢。
1回复

如何确保我传递给节点获取请求的标头是正确的?

我正在尝试重写一个函数,该函数使用 request-promise 库执行基于节点获取的 get 请求: 这是请求承诺中的方法: import { default as request } from 'request-promise'; async function sendGet(cookie
1回复

获取请求响应中的请求承诺是否重复?

我的服务器中有以下路由: 带有get请求的request-promise调用一个外部API。 然后,来自外部API的请求将解析为简化的有效负载。 将请求承诺包装在get请求中,然后返回此减少的有效负载。 第一次调用我的get请求时,它将正确返回有效负载,但是再次请求时,它将多次返回
1回复

在 Node.js 中请求信息时延迟 promise 请求

我正在使用gpapi库来查找 Play 商店并存储有关在 Play 商店中找到的应用程序的信息。 我首先找到一个应用程序的相关应用程序(大约 20 个应用程序),然后我请求每个应用程序的详细信息。 这是由库作为承诺请求完成的。 我尝试在请求之间添加一个延迟,因为在当前状态下,所有请求都是同时执行的,
2回复

如何忽略请求中的自签名证书问题

我正在为节点应用程序使用请求承诺模块进行一些API调用。 https://www.npmjs.com/package/request-promise 因为我要使用的API不安全(具有自签名证书),所以连接失败并显示以下错误: 错误:连接ECONNREFUSED 我知道
3回复

函数返回 undefined 而不是请求结果

我在 javascript 中的异步有一些问题。 有一个函数(下一个)重复向服务器发送 REST API 请求。 这些函数将调用自身,直到找到根 ID。 你可以在现场找到 console.log('the root ID is connected!') 。 之后,我需要最后一个请求 ID 作为函数(
2回复

检查所有要完成的请求

我目前正在开发一个异步获取多个 URI 的抓取工具。 我的问题是,我想等待处理所有响应,但我不知道如何找出每个响应的处理时间。 最后一个带有“完成!”的日志甚至在响应返回之前运行。 感谢您帮助 Xaver :)